    Chelsea make decision on loaning out youngster Noni Madueke in January transfer window

    Noni Madueke will not be sent out on loan in January despite his lacklustre start to the season at Chelsea, according to reports.

    Madueke signed from PSV Eindhoven last winter but has struggled to make his imprint on Mauricio Pochettino’s side since the Argentinian’s arrival over the summer.

    The Englishman has started just two games in all competitions – making eight appearances in total – and has missed several games through injury.

    Some had expected the 21-year-old to leave in January on loan to get more game time in the second half of the season, but such a move is unlikely to be allowed, according to The Athletic.

    Chelsea already have the maximum number of players out on international loans, meaning any potential loan would have to be to a domestic club.

    But Madueke is expected to remain with the first-team squad as they prioritise permanent outgoings to fund any January incomings.

    One player who may potentially leave the club in the new year, however, is central midfielder Conor Gallagher.

    The Englishman has only 18 months left on his contract, with reports suggesting the Blues will consider offers for him in January to help raise funds for a new striker.

    When asked about the midfielder’s situation following their 2-0 win over Sheffield United, Pochettino said: ‘That is between the club and the player.

    ‘I don’t need to talk too much because it is not my decision. He is in the starting eleven in nearly all the games and is one of the captains. For me, he is the type of player that the club needs to have.’

    Following their win over Sheffield United, Chelsea host Newcastle in midweek as they look to progress to the semi-finals of the Carabao Cup.

    Madueke, who missed Chelsea’s last three games through injury, has returned to full fitness and could be in line for a rare start.
